Output e4c64c961cf300f1f398771bfd57cfc7bba30b12fec3b0297bdff53d6a00ae3f:0

value
1808000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82dc35469dbcf8fa0280c0b3c1ddf4cb42dedb55 OP_EQUAL
address
3DcwZotsGLv96LpLBa8D23Acou7tpPwZcg
transaction
e4c64c961cf300f1f398771bfd57cfc7bba30b12fec3b0297bdff53d6a00ae3f
spent
true